Skip to main content

Co to jest routing źródłowy?

Routing źródłowy to technika stosowana w sieci komputerowej, która pozwala użytkownikowi kierować pakiety danych sieci do określonego miejsca docelowego.W zależności od tego, w jaki sposób jest używane, pakiety mogą otrzymać określoną ścieżkę do podjęcia lub ogólnych kierunków, co pozwoli niektórym automatycznym routingowi sieciowe obsłużyć część ścieżki.Chociaż jest to bardzo przydatna technika, jest również bardzo podatna na nadużycie, umożliwiając potencjalne naruszenia bezpieczeństwa.

Większość normalnego routingu odbywa się przez wiele urządzeń, zwanych routerami, które składają się na wiele sieci, które obejmują Internet.Urządzenia te są zaprogramowane z protokołami, które pozwalają im dowiedzieć się o swoich sąsiadach, a następnie decydować o najlepszych możliwych ścieżkach, które należy podjąć podczas kierowania ruchem sieciowym z jednego komputera do drugiego.Z drugiej strony routing źródłowy wykorzystuje niektóre opcjonalne funkcje protokołu internetowego (IP), który usuwa podejmowanie decyzji z routerów i stawia je w ręce użytkownika lub komputer źródłowy.Modyfikacje routingu źródłowego, które komputer może wprowadzić do pakietu danych, gdy kieruje się do sieci: surowe lub luźne.Przy ścisłych definicjach źródła dokładna ścieżka, którą powinien podjąć pakiet, od jednego routera do drugiego, jest określona, zanim pakiet opuści komputer źródłowy.LUSKIE ROUTOWANIE DOBRY DODAJ PACKET Kilka konkretnych punktów routera i pozwala innym routerom decydować po drodze.Jest to przydatne, na przykład, jeśli wysyłasz pakiet za pośrednictwem lokalnych routerów sieciowych do routera bramy, a następnie na określony adres.Lokalne routery sieciowe można pominąć, ale można określić bramę i inne routery.

Możliwość korzystania z routingu źródłowego jest przydatna do różnych celów testowania i rozwiązywania problemów.Jednym z takich celów jest uczenie się ulic sąsiedzkich, w których sieć jest odkrywana poprzez śledzenie trasy pakietów z jednego routera do drugiego.Może to być również przydatne do odkrycia, gdzie występują potencjalne wąskie gardło sieciowe i są często używane przez dostawców usług internetowych (ISP), aby upewnić się, że niepotrzebny ruch danych nie próbuje skorzystać z ich głównych kręgosłupa sieci.Metoda jest również stosowana do celów nikczemnych, umożliwiając atakującemu uzyskanie dostępu do komputerów w sieci prywatnej poprzez udawanie komputera w tej prywatnej sieci.

Gdy sieci bezprzewodowe stały się popularne, inna technika nazywana routingiem źródła (DSR (DSR) został opracowany, który wykorzystuje routing źródłowy do odkrycia sieci bezprzewodowej.Sztuczka powstała, ponieważ ponieważ węzły sieciowe są znane i często pochodzą z niektórych rodzajów sieci bezprzewodowych, tych określanych jako sieci ad-hoc komputery potrzebowały nowego sposobu szybkiego odkrywania tras wokół sieci.W ten sposób trasa z komputera źródłowego za pośrednictwem sieci jest odkryta w locie, w razie potrzeby, zamiast węzłów ciągle zalewającą sieć aktualizowanymi informacjami, gdy węzły przychodzą i odchodzą.